How to display the data in a row of a table

    i can use snmptable to display the whole table, but
    how to disply a row of table?
    The type of table index is IpAddress and i set
    the index via snmp_set_var_value() as the following:

<table>_get_first[next]_data_point() {
    ...
    vptr = put_index_data;
    snmp_set_var_value(vptr, (u_char *)&addr_ip, sizeof(in_addr_t));
    ...
}

    When i tried the following command for instance with index 230.0.0.1,
    "snmpget -v 2c -c private <remotehost> recMCAddressTable.230.0.0.1"

    i got:
    "...::recMCAddressTable.230.0.0.1 = No Such Object available on this 
agent at this OID"

    What is the correct usage of snmp command to dispaly a row of table?
